The Oncology Educator will design and deliver training programs for clinical care team members, including onboarding and continuing education. They will also monitor clinical quality, refine workflows, and travel to new markets to support go-live readiness.
Daymark Health is a value-based oncology company redefining the cancer care experience for patients, providers, and health plans. Daymark’s comprehensive, personalized cancer care platform empowers patients with dedicated care navigation, symptom-focused support, behavioral health care, and social resources. Combined with evidence-based health interventions and a hybrid in-person + virtual care model, Daymark is improving the overall cancer experience for patients, providers, and health plans – and setting a new standard in cancer care.
Daymark’s groundbreaking approach is led by CEO Dr. Justin Bekelman, a pioneer in transforming cancer care, alongside some of the nation’s foremost leaders in oncology and value-based care. Daymark Health is backed by Maverick Ventures, Yosemite, Oncology Ventures, Healthier Capital, Blue Venture Fund, and Healthcare Foundry.

ABOUT THE ROLE
As Daymark's Oncology Educator, Learning & Development, you will support the design, delivery, and continuous improvement of training across the organization, with a particular focus on our Care Team members: Registered Nurses, Nurse Practitioners, LCSWs, and Community Health Navigators. Reporting to the VP of Oncology Nursing and working closely with the Manager, Learning & Development, you'll bring clinical credibility and hands-on care experience to our training programs, helping ensure that what we teach reflects how care actually happens at the bedside — or in the home. This is a great role for an experienced nurse trainer while staying close to clinical practice, oncology, and value-based care.

Additional Information
The expected compensation for this role is $100,000 to $120,000 annually, depending on location & experience.
This role is fully remote but will require up to 25% travel.
